The Health and Human Services System in Texas is seeking a vendor to provide comprehensive software development, technical support, maintenance, and ongoing support services for its Integrated Eligibility Redesign project. Responsibilities include developing, modifying, and maintaining automated database build scripts, as well as Data Description Language (DDL) and Data Manipulation Language (DML) scripts that are environment-agnostic to effectively implement database changes across all environments.
The selected vendor will be required to update and maintain supporting documentation to resolve database-related issues, build and maintain scripts for deploying code in various environments, and assist agency staff in troubleshooting issues related to contractor-developed applications. Additionally, adherence to the agency's processes for resolving data errors is required, including performing root cause analysis and updating affected records. The contract is intended for a period of one year.
